Located in Section 14 of Orange Township, this mostly tillable farm offers an exceptional combination of productive agricultural ground, fertile soils, recreational opportunities, and quality trophy whitetail habitat. With over 40 acres of productive tillable farmland and a productivity index (PI) of 110.1, the property presents an excellent opportunity for farmers, investors, and landowners looking to expand their operation or add a quality tract to their portfolio. The propertys fertile farmland provides strong agricultural potential, while Haw Creek frontage and diverse habitat add significant recreational appeal. The combination of tillable acreage, water resources, and quality cover creates an attractive environment for wildlife, including excellent potential for trophy whitetail deer. In addition to its agricultural value, the farm offers opportunities for hunting and outdoor recreation. Properties that combine this level of farm productivity with quality recreational attributes are increasingly difficult to find, making this a versatile investment with multiple potential uses. Access is convenient with gravel road frontage extending along the entire west side of the property.
